The Role of Binding Iron Wire


Binding iron wire is a versatile product known for its strength, durability, and flexibility. It is primarily used for binding, tying, and fastening in numerous projects, including construction, fencing, and craft applications. The ability of binding wire to hold components together securely makes it a go-to material for builders, landscapers, and artisans alike.


In construction, for example, binding wire is crucial for reinforcement purposes. Builders use it to hold rebar in place, ensuring that concrete structures maintain their integrity and strength over time. This application alone highlights how essential binding iron wire is to safe and effective building practices.


The Manufacturing Process


Producing binding iron wire involves several key steps that require precision and efficiency. Initially, raw materials, primarily iron or steel, are sourced and processed. The production begins with melting these metals and then moving to the drawing process, where the molten metal is transformed into wire strands.


After extrusion, the wire undergoes a series of drawing processes where its thickness is reduced, and its length is extended. This is done through a series of dies, which ensure that each strand meets stringent quality standards. Following this, the wire can be treated with different coatings, including galvanization, to enhance its resistance to rust and corrosion.


Once the wire is produced, it is wound into coils for easy handling and transportation. Quality control is an essential part of the manufacturing process, ensuring that the final products meet industry standards and customer specifications.

Innovations in the Industry


The binding iron wire manufacturing industry continuously evolves, integrating technological advancements to enhance efficiency and product quality. Automation plays a significant role in modern factories, with robotic systems handling much of the loading, unloading, and packaging processes. This not only speeds up production but also minimizes human error, ensuring a higher level of consistency in the quality of the wire produced.


Moreover, recent innovations in materials science have led to the development of wires that not only meet traditional standards of strength and flexibility but also offer improved resistance to environmental factors. These advancements allow for the production of specialized wires designed for specific applications, such as hurricane-resistant fencing or biodegradable binding options for gardening.


Environmental Considerations


As with many manufacturing processes, binding iron wire factories face increasing pressure to adopt sustainable practices. The raw materials used in the production of binding wire can have significant environmental impacts. As a result, many factories are now incorporating recycled metals into their production processes, reducing waste and minimizing their carbon footprint.


In addition to sourcing sustainable materials, factories are also looking at energy-efficient processes and eco-friendly packaging options. These shifts not only benefit the environment but also appeal to a growing segment of consumers who prioritize sustainability.
